PostgreSQL PostgreSQL是一个功能强大的开源关系型数据库管理系统(DBMS),它具有丰富的特性和高度的可扩展性、可靠性和安全性,被广泛应用于各种企业级应用和数据密集型应用。PostgreSQL支持复杂的数据类型、事务处理和并发控制,适用于处理大规模数据和高并发访问的场景。PostgreSQL还提供了丰富的扩展和插件,可以满足各种需求。
PostgreSQL、MySQL和MariaDB都是流行的关系型数据库管理系统,各有其特点和适用场景。 PostgreSQL 特点: 支持大部分SQL标准,并提供了许多现代特性,如复杂查询、外键、触发器、视图、事务完整性、MVCC等。 可以用许多方法扩展,比如通过增加新的数据类型、函数、操作符、聚集函数、索引方法、过程语言等。 许可证灵活,任何...
MySQL与MariaDB是非常相似的两种数据库系统,MariaDB最初是作为MySQL的一个分支开始的。以下是它们之间的...
使用SQL查看当前数据库版本 在SQL中查看当前数据库版本的方法取决于你使用的具体数据库管理系统。以下是一些常见数据库及其对应查看版本的SQL命令: MySQL 或 MariaDB: SELECT VERSION(); Oracle: SELECT * FROM v$version; PostgreSQL: SELECT version(); SQLite: SELECT sqlite_version(); SQL Server: SELECT @@V...
com/viter/p/10243577.html],介绍了 EFCore 连接 MSSQL 的使用方法,在本章中,将继续介绍如何利用 EFCore 连接到MariaDB/MySql和PostgreSQL数据库,同时,在一个项目中,如何添加多个数据库上下文对象,并在业务中使用多个上下文对象,通过这两章的学习,你将掌握使用 EFCore 连接 MSSQL/MariaDB/MySql/PostgreSQL 的...
两位MariaDB的前高管自己创业,方向是帮助用户从 MySQL 迁移到PostgreSQL上。截图来自他们在PGCon上的分享「The Future of MySQL is Postgres」。标题的倾向性比较明显,不过内容上还是比较客观地比较了 MySQL 和 PostgreSQL。 PostgreSQL 正在吸引更多的人。
请将示例代码中的<host>、<username>、<password>和<database_name>替换为适当的值。 结论 通过按照上述步骤连接到数据库服务器、获取数据库列表、查询每个数据库的表数量,并计算每个数据库的占有率,我们可以实现MySQL、PostgreSQL和MariaDB的占有率功能。这将帮助我们了解每个数据库在整个数据库系统中的使用情况。
许可证 License MySQL 社区版采用 GPL 许可证。Postgres 发布在 PostgreSQL 许可下,是一种类似于 BSD 或 MIT 的自由开源许可。即便 MySQL 采用了 GPL,仍有人担心 MySQL 归 Oracle 所有,这也是为什么 MariaDB 从 MySQL 分叉出来。性能 Performance 对于大多数工作负载来说,Postgres 和 MySQL 的性能相当,最多...
比如,专注软件开发者的行业分析公司 Redmonk 分析师 James Governor 提到,“目前开发者们有一些 NoSQL 和大数据的疲劳”,因此,开发人员开始使用久经考验的 PostgreSQL 作为 MongoDB 和 Apache Cassandra 的可行替代方案,用于一些关键工作负载。 另外,云计算公司 Joyent 的解决方案工程总监 Elijah Zupancic 也提到了文档...
MySQL历史概览:1995年由瑞典公司MySQL AB创立以来,MySQL凭借其出色的性能和灵活性,逐渐成为了全球范围内广泛使用的数据库软件之一。2008年被Sun收购,2010年Sun又被Oracle收购,随后Oracle进一步收购了MySQL。为了应对这一变化,MySQL的创始人在2012年创立了新的分支MariaDB。在数据库领域,PostgreSQL与MySQL各自有着独特...